What will you do?
WoT Regional Licensing Manager will work with external licensing partners of Wargaming and World of Tanks, as well as be responsible for managing multiple product categories and licensees with the goal of meeting/exceeding revenue targets and growth objectives for World of Tanks.
The WoT Regional Licensing Manager will:
- Be a product ambassador who understands and shares product goals and requirements as they apply to licensing
- Drive regional licensing and business development activities in coordination with relevant stakeholders to bring new World of Tanks licensing products to market
- Ensure licensee products reflect World of Tanks quality and brand/property objectives
- Strategize, identify, and develop new business opportunities for licensing in the CIS in alignment with World of Tanks roadmap and product categories priority
- Build senior-level relationships with partners (existing and prospective) on behalf of the product
- Act as the main point of contact for relevant licensing projects, negotiate with prospective partners, help resolve any issues, and ensure compliance with agreements
- Negotiate financial deal points and other material terms on new deals and renewals
- Manage the process from concept and pitch to licensee onboarding, contract negotiation, contract signature, new product approval cycle, resolving issues, and promotional/advertising initiatives
- Work in close collaboration with Legal, Content, Marketing, Finance & other Teams
- Analyze account business performance, develop and implement product strategies, and manage promotion plans to ensure product sales are maximized and KPI objectives are met
- Provide regular reports, prepare quarterly royalties statements & payments
- Create and maintain internal documentation on prospective and existing licensing deals
- Research & understand the competitive landscape
- Provide regional insights on licensing and business opportunities in the region, analyze and understand market trends, as well as consumer, retailer, and industry needs to make strategic recommendations for new key business partners brands, retail, and distribution channels to maximize profitability and build brand equity
- Work in collaboration with the global team on licensing product strategy for global contracts
- Build strong relationships across regional and global teams to ensure the achievement of business objectives, operational processes, and operational efficiency

About Wargaming:
Wargaming is an award-winning online game developer and publisher headquartered in Nicosia, Cyprus. Operating since 1998, Wargaming has grown to become one of the leaders in the gaming industry with 5,500 employees and 18 offices spread worldwide. Over 200 million players enjoy Wargaming's titles across all major gaming platforms. Our flagship products include the free-to-play hits World of Tanks and World of Warships, as well as World of Tanks Blitz — the critically acclaimed mobile tank shooter with cross-platform support.
